SATTE 2022 postponed by three months

Following the recent spike in the number of Covid-19 cases in India, the show dates for SATTE, South Asia’s largest trade exhibition for the travel and tourism sector, have been rescheduled. The show will now be organised from May 18-20, 2022, in Greater Noida, near Delhi, says Informa Markets in India, the organiser of the B2B travel trade exhibition. SATTE was originally slated for February 16-18, 2022 at the same venue.

Thailand reopens 3 more Sandbox destinations from January 11, 2022

Thailand’s Centre for Covid-19 Situation Administration (CCSA) approves a new round of relaxed entry measures for international arrivals to Thailand, reopening three more Sandbox destinations – Krabi, Phang-Nga, and Surat Thani (only Ko Samui, Ko Pha-ngan, and Ko Tao) from January 11, 2022, in addition to Phuket.
